About Sharon Hills Elementary School
Sharon Hills Elementary School is a regular public elementary school in East Baton Rouge Parish, Louisiana. Serving students from pre-kindergarten through fifth grade, the school has an enrollment of 245 students and maintains a student-teacher ratio of 13.6:1 with 18 full-time equivalent teachers. The school's location in a large suburban area provides a supportive community setting for learning.
Sharon Hills Elementary School focuses on fostering a nurturing environment where young minds can grow and develop. With a MySchoolScout rating of 3.9 out of 10, the school is ranked at #1058 out of 1290 schools in Louisiana, placing it in the 18th percentile. Academically, the combined proficiency rate across all grades stands at 10%, with 34% proficient or above in ELA/Reading and 29% proficient or above in Math.

Performance Trends
Math proficiency has declined from 52% (2019) to 22% (2022). Reading/ELA proficiency has declined from 62% (2019) to 22% (2022).

Community Profile
The community surrounding Sharon Hills Elementary School has a median household income of $41,195. It is a community where 19%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$161,900, with a median rent of $876/month. The area has a poverty rate of 24.4%, indicating some economic challenges in the community. The average commute for residents is 27 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
